    Siemens to supply signalling on Alger metro extension

    2013-08-13T08:39:00Z

    ALGERIA: Entreprise Métro d’Alger has selected Siemens to supply signalling for the extension of Alger metro Line 1. The contract is worth €20m and includes training of staff in the new system. The extension will be equipped with Siemens Trainguard MT communications based train control, permitting automatic train operation. ...

    Maryland Purple Line to be a PPP project

    2013-08-08T13:00:00Z

    USA: Maryland’s first public-private partnership in the public transport sector will be the Purple Line light rail route, Governor of Maryland Martin O’Malley announced on August 5. The 25·7 km east–west Purple Line would link New Carrollton in Prince George’s County and Bethesda in Montgomery County, with 19 intermediate ...

    EcoTram starts test running in Wien

    2013-08-08T10:30:00Z

    AUSTRIA: A Siemens Ultra Low Floor tram equipped with technology to reduce energy consumption has begun test running in passenger service in Wien. The ULF tram will operate on Route 62 until May 2014. As part of the EcoTram project, the tram has been equipped with intelligent control units ...

    Siemens awarded Gurgaon metro extension contract

    2013-08-06T10:15:00Z

    INDIA: IL&FS Rail has awarded Siemens a €70m turnkey contract to supply electrification, signalling and rolling stock for the 6·5 km Gurgaon metro Phase II extension. The six-station extension to the standard-gauge line is due to open in late 2015 or 2016. It will have a capacity of 30 ...

    Mumbai metro Line 3 approved

    2013-07-30T09:19:00Z

    INDIA: The government gave the go-ahead for Mumbai metro Line 3 at the end of June. The 33·5 km standard-gauge line running underground between Colaba, Bandra and Santacruz Electronics Export Processing Zone is expected to cost Rs231·36bn, with work to start this year for completion by March 2019. ...

    Athens Line 2 extended south

    2013-07-29T13:00:00Z

    GREECE: A 5·5 km southern extension of Athens metro Line 2 opened to the public on July 26. The extension from Aghios Dimitrios has four stations at Ilioupoli, Alimos, Argyroupoli and a terminus at Elliniko. Alimos and Argyroupoli feature displays of archaeological finds unearthed during construction. The project cost ...

    Land Transport Authority awards Thomson Line contracts

    2013-07-29T06:00:00Z

    SINGAPORE: Land Transport Authority has awarded a S$285m contract for the construction of Caldecott metro station and associated tunnels to Samsung C&T Corp. Construction is due to start in August for completion in 2020. The station will be an interchange between the under construction Thomson Line and the Circle Line. ...
